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Identify the source of the leak and assess the extent of the damage.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and identify the underlying cause of the leak.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Remove standing water and extract moisture from the affected area using our state-of-the-art equipment.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Speed up the drying process with our advanced dehumidification equipment and techniques. This ensures that your property is thoroughly dry and ready for restoration.
Step 4: Restoration and Reconstruction
Restore your property to its original condition, or better, with our expert reconstruction services. From drywall to flooring, we’ll work with you to ensure that every detail is perfect.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Quality Control
Verify the quality of our work and ensure that your property is safe and secure. We’ll conduct a thorough inspection to guarantee that every aspect of the restoration is complete and satisfactory.

Warning Signs You Need Pinhole Leak Water Removal
Catching pinhole leaks early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Don’t ignore the smell it could be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to remove the odor.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Check for water damage behind the stains, and don’t assume it’s just a minor issue. Our technicians can help you assess the damage and provide a plan for restoration.
Increased Water Bills
Monitor your water usage and report any sudden spikes to your local water authority. This could be a sign of a hidden leak or water dam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Inspect your flooring regularly for signs of water damage, and don’t wait until it’s too late. Our team can help you restore your flooring to its original condition.
Visible Water Damage or Leaks
Don’t delay address visible water damage or leaks immediately to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Juno Beach, FL
The cost of pinhole leak water removal in Juno Beach, FL can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of standing water.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the type of materials needed for reconstruction. |
| Mold Remediation | $1,500 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of mold growth. |
| Final Inspection and Quality Control | $500 – $1,000 | The complexity of the restoration and the level of detail required. |

Common Questions About Pinhole Leak Water Removal
How long does pinhole leak water removal take?
We typically complete pinhole leak water removal within 3-5 days dep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to reduce disruption to your daily life.
Is pinhole leak water removal covered by insurance?
Yes, pinhole leak water removal is often covered by insurance but the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. Our team will help you navigate the insurance process and ensure that you receive the coverage you deserve.
Can I prevent pinhole leaks from occurring?
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ent pinhole leaks. Our team recommends checking your pipes and plumbing system regularly for signs of wear and tear, and addressing any issues quickly to prevent costly repairs.
How do I know if I have a pinhole leak?
Look for signs of water damage, such as warping or buckling flooring, water stains on the ceiling or walls, and musty odors. If you suspect a pinhole leak, contact our team immediately for a prompt and efficient solution.
